    MDR are not getting a cut from the tap to refill function. Do you mean 40% of app users are utilising this function? Pharmacies pay a flat $100/month. Keep in mind though that they are offering a $1 rebate for every patient signed up at the moment. This means that pharmacies which are signing up a lot of patients would be paying very little or even nothing.

    https://www.medadvisor.com.au/Pharmacist/Pricing#

    I think at this stage of the company's life it is too early to focus on revenue. I've always believed that eventually MDR won't generate most of its revenue from pharmacy subscriptions. There will be revenue from referrals for Home Medication Reviews and home/office deliveries. GP link is only in its beta testing phase. Relationships with pharmaceutical companies (which imo is where the real money is) is also in its infancy. Give it time.
